Summary: | This final project contains the process of designing reinforced concrete office
structures located in Jakarta. Office buildings have a total of 26 floors with a total
height of 110.64 m. In this building there are functions of offices and lobby lifts on
one floor for floors 1 to 25, one floor for mechanics on the 26th floor, and the upper
part functions as a flat roof. The seismic structural system used is a dual system,
consisting of Special Moment Frames (SMF) and Special Structural Wall (SSW).
The building structure is modeled using ETABS and designed based on SNI 1726-
2012 for earthquake resistant building analysis, SNI 2847-2013 for reinforced
concrete building designs, and SNI 1727-2013 for gravity loading. Earthquake
resistant building analysis consists of checking structural irregularities, P-Delta
effect, story drift, dual system, redundancy factors, and collector elements.
Structural element detailing is done manually for beams, columns, joints, shear
walls, coupling beams, and diaphragms based on internal forces obtained from
ETABS. Detailed plate elements will be assisted by SAFE software. |
